About U. Sukhatme
U. Sukhatme is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Geometry and Topology and Structural Biology, having authored 119 papers that have together received 6.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Mechanics and Non-Hermitian Physics (54 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(41 papers),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(40 papers), High-Energy Particle Collisions Research (35 papers), Quantum chaos and dynamical systems (35 papers), Nonlinear Waves and Solitons (22 papers), Cold Atom Physics and Bose-Einstein Condensates (10 papers) and Algebraic structures and combinatorial models (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(4.0k cit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(2.2k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(4.6k citations), Applied Mathematics (413 citations) and Geometry and Topology (283 citations). U. Sukhatme has collaborated with scholars based in United States, India and France. Frequent co-authors include Avinash Khare, Fred Cooper, Tom D. Imbo, J. Trân Thanh Vân, A. Capella, Ranabir Dutt, A. Pagnamenta, Corey Tan, R. Dutt and Asim Gangopadhyaya. Their work appears in journals such as Physics Letters B, Physics Letters A, Physical Review A, Nuclear Physics B and Physical Review Letters.
